초록

Perilla frutescens (L.) is an annual herbaceous and ornamental plant in the Lamiaceae family. Perilla frutescens (L.) Britt.cv.Chookyoupjaso were irradiated using a 200 Gy gamma ray in 1995. By HPLC analysis, this new cultivar significantly induced isoegomaketone content compared with ‘Chookyoupjaso’ control. The phenotypical difference was the changed leaf color of the ‘Atom-Ketone’ from violet to green. The yield potential of this cultivar (106 kg/10a) was 1.83 folds higher than that of ‘Chookyoupjaso’ (57.65 kg/10a). The methanol extracts of ‘Atom-Ketone’ inhibit nitric oxide (NO) production in LPS-stimulated RAW 264.7 cells. This extract was further partitioned using ethyl acetate (EtOAc), butanol (BuOH), and water. The EtOAc fraction (EF-Atom-Ketone) was evaluated for antiinflammatory activities. These results indicated that the EF-Atom-Ketone reduced NO production by inhibiting inducible nitric oxide synthase (iNOS) expression.
